The Three NFPA Levels

The Three NFPA Chimney Inspection Levels Explained in Castle Hills, TX

Level 1

The Annual Baseline Check in Castle Hills

Annual safety baseline for chimneys in regular service with the same appliance and no system changes in Castle Hills, TX. Visual inspection of accessible portions without special equipment in Castle Hills. Firebox, damper, visible smoke chamber, as much of the flue as can be seen, accessible exterior components in Castle Hills, TX. Topdown Chimney includes a basic Level 1 assessment with every sweep service in Castle Hills.

Level 2

The Camera Scan That Sees What Nothing Else Can in Castle Hills, TX

Everything in Level 1 plus a full camera scan of the flue interior and a written inspection report in Castle Hills. The camera scan is the element that makes Level 2 fundamentally more revealing than Level 1 in Castle Hills, TX. NFPA 211 requires Level 2 when a property changes hands in Castle Hills. Also required after any chimney fire, fuel type change, or when Level 1 findings warrant closer examination in Castle Hills, TX.

Level 3

When the Structure Needs Invasive Assessment in Castle Hills

Involves removing structural components to access concealed areas when Level 2 findings cannot be fully characterized through camera scan alone in Castle Hills, TX. May require removing masonry, chimney components, or adjacent building materials in Castle Hills. Topdown Chimney performs Level 3 when Level 2 findings genuinely warrant it and explains clearly before proceeding in Castle Hills, TX.

After Any Suspected or Confirmed Chimney Fire in Castle Hills

The heat of a chimney fire exceeds 2,000 degrees Fahrenheit and causes clay tile liners to expand and contract rapidly, cracking tile sections and separating mortar joints in Castle Hills, TX. Level 2 camera inspection after any suspected chimney fire is essential before the fireplace is used again in Castle Hills.

What We Assess

What Topdown Chimney Assesses During Every Inspection in Castle Hills, TX

Firebox and Damper — The Starting Point in Castle Hills

The firebox refractory brick and mortar are inspected for cracking, spalling, and structural deterioration in Castle Hills, TX. The damper is assessed for correct operation, physical condition including corrosion and deformation, and adequate seal when closed in Castle Hills. The transition between the firebox and smoke chamber is assessed for smoke chamber parge coat condition in Castle Hills, TX.

Flue Liner — Visual at Level 1, Camera at Level 2 in Castle Hills

At Level 1, the flue liner is assessed through visual inspection from the firebox opening and from the chimney top in Castle Hills, TX. At Level 2, the complete liner is documented through camera scan providing direct visual evidence of liner condition throughout the full flue height in Castle Hills. Crack location and severity. Mortar joint condition between tile sections. Physical liner damage from chimney fires. Liner sizing relative to the connected appliance in Castle Hills, TX.

Crown, Cap, Flashing, and Exterior Masonry in Castle Hills, TX

The chimney crown is inspected from rooftop level for cracking, correct formation, and structural integrity in Castle Hills. The rain cap is inspected for correct fit, mesh integrity, and physical condition in Castle Hills, TX. The full flashing system is inspected close-up from the rooftop in Castle Hills. Counter flashing sealant condition. Base flashing metal condition. Step flashing integrity on all four chimney sides in Castle Hills, TX. The exterior chimney masonry is assessed for mortar joint condition, brick spalling, and efflorescence patterns in Castle Hills.

The Camera Inspection

The Camera Inspection — What It Shows and Why It Matters in Castle Hills, TX

What Camera Inspection Sees That Direct Observation Cannot in Castle Hills

The camera scan is the defining element of a Level 2 inspection in Castle Hills, TX. It travels the complete flue from the firebox to the chimney top and produces direct visual documentation of liner condition throughout in Castle Hills. Hairline cracks in clay tile liner sections that are completely invisible to direct observation from the firebox or chimney top in Castle Hills, TX. Mortar joint separation between liner sections that allows combustion gases to migrate into the surrounding masonry in Castle Hills. Physical liner damage from chimney fires including cracked and displaced tile sections in Castle Hills, TX. Evidence of previous chimney fires that the homeowner may not know occurred in Castle Hills. And previous repair attempts including whether they addressed the complete extent of the damage or only the accessible sections in Castle Hills, TX.

Why Real Estate Transactions Require Level 2 in Castle Hills

NFPA 211 requires Level 2 inspection when a property changes hands in Castle Hills, TX. The requirement exists because the chimney is one of the most expensive systems in the home to repair when significant conditions are found, and its most significant conditions are only identifiable through camera inspection of the liner in Castle Hills. A general home inspector's visual assessment from below the firebox and from ground level outside is not a substitute for the camera scan that Level 2 requires in Castle Hills, TX. It is a different scope and a different level of information in Castle Hills.

A chimney sweep removes creosote and debris from the flue for fire prevention in Castle Hills. A chimney inspection is a systematic assessment of the chimney system's structural integrity, component condition, and operating safety in Castle Hills, TX. A sweep addresses what is in the chimney. An inspection addresses the condition of the chimney itself in Castle Hills. Both are important annual services and Topdown Chimney performs both in a combined visit in Castle Hills, TX.

A chimney fire occurs when creosote deposits in the flue ignite in Castle Hills. It burns at temperatures exceeding 2,000 degrees Fahrenheit and produces physical stress on the liner that causes cracking and mortar joint separation in clay tile liners in Castle Hills, TX. Many chimney fires are not recognized as such because they may burn out quickly without dramatic visible signs in Castle Hills. Camera inspection reveals the specific physical damage signatures that distinguish chimney fire damage from normal thermal cycling deterioration in Castle Hills, TX.
